My hair is really fine, but occasional ponytails work ok. I can wear a ponytail as often as every 3 days and not get breakage or traction alopecia problems. Someone with stronger hair could likely do them more often and still be fine. The big thing is to not go for a super tight ponytail, and not get into a habit of doing your hair the exact same way every day. Change up the location on your head, and make sure that your hairdo isn't giving you an accidental face lift. But ANY style where you do it super tight, every day and in the same spot every day can be a problem, not just ponytails.
